How do you get a service manual for 97 Cadillac divilla?

Finding a service manual for a 1997 Cadillac DeVille can be tricky, but here are your best options:

* Online Retailers: Sites like Amazon, eBay, and even used-book sellers often have service manuals available, both physical copies and digital downloads (PDFs). Search for "1997 Cadillac DeVille service manual" or "1997 Cadillac DeVille repair manual." Be aware that prices can vary widely depending on condition and format.

* Repair Manual Publishers: Companies like Haynes and Chilton publish repair manuals for many vehicles. Check their websites to see if they offer one specifically for a 1997 Cadillac DeVille. Keep in mind these are often more simplified than factory manuals.

* Factory Service Manuals (OEM): These are the most comprehensive, but also the most difficult to obtain. GM (General Motors) doesn't generally make these easily available to the public. You might find some through specialized automotive parts websites or online forums dedicated to Cadillac enthusiasts. These are usually expensive if found.

* Online Forums and Communities: Cadillac-specific forums (search for "Cadillac DeVille forum") are a great resource. Members often share information, links to manuals, or might even have a copy they'd be willing to share (though be mindful of copyright).

* Libraries: Some larger public libraries might have automotive repair manuals in their collections. It's worth checking with your local library system.

Tips for your search:

* Be specific: When searching online, use the full year and model (1997 Cadillac DeVille) to avoid getting irrelevant results.

* Check the contents: Before purchasing a digital manual, check the table of contents to ensure it covers the systems and components you need information on.

* Consider a subscription service: Some websites offer subscription-based access to online repair manuals covering a wide range of vehicles.
